Germanys high-tech isolation wards remained on alert on Friday, ready to receive Ebola patients should they be required to. German airports seemed less prepared for the potential dangers of the viral epidemic, however.
Hamburgs University clinic Hamburg-Eppendorf (UKE) said on Friday it remains prepared and ready to take Ebola patients from the outbreak in west Africa, despite not expecting any in the immediate future. [ ]
The infectious Ebola virus has killed 672 people in Liberia, Sierra Leone and Guinea since February in the worlds largest ever recorded outbreak of the disease.
The World Health Organization (WHO) is still struggling to gain control of the virus for which there is no vaccine and no cure.
The current outbreak of Ebola, which started at the beginning of this year, has killed 55 percent of those it has infected.
